Beware of green onions

According to a recent survey, onion thrips are seriously jeopardized in onion fields, 200 to 300 tubes, and the damage rate is over 60%. The formation of contiguous leukoplakia on the damaged onion leaves has seriously affected the growth and quality of the onion, and reminded the farmers to prevent and control it in time.

Onion thrips is commonly known as thrips, mainly on the scallions, shallots, onions, shallots, leeks, garlic, etc. Lily family vegetables, adults and nymphs suck sucking mouthparts to suck the leaves juice, so that the onion leaves form many fine long Yellow-white spots, when the leaves are yellow and white, twisted and dead. Occurs 3 to 10 generations a year, and generally begins to breed in the spring. As the temperature rises, the hazards increase, and the period from May to June reaches its peak. High temperature and drought are beneficial to it. Onion thrips are generally hidden during the day and endangered at night, and cloudy days can be hazardous throughout the day.

Prevention:

1. Remove stubble and dead leaves of field weeds and former crops in time to reduce the source of insects.

2. Watering in time when drought occurs. Use a method of pouring water with small water to increase the humidity in the field and suppress the damage of the onion thrips.

3. Chemical control can be sprayed with 10% imidacloprid wettable powder, 3% acetamiprid EC 2000 times, 4.5% beta cypermethrin EC or 2.5% kungfu EC (cyhalothrin) 1500 times. Note that 7-10 days after spraying can be harvested to ensure food safety. Http://
